CJP Protest Day 25: Wangchuk's Health Worsens as Fast Enters 17th Day

On day 25 of the ongoing protest by the Campaign for Justice and Peace (CJP), the health of activist Wangchuk has deteriorated, with his hunger strike entering its 17th day. The protest, which began in late February 2025, has drawn attention to demands for judicial reforms and accountability in the region. Notable figures including author Arundhati Roy and actor Naseeruddin Shah have publicly urged the protesters to end the hunger strike, citing health risks. The protest has seen periodic clashes with authorities and has garnered mixed public support. No official statements from the government have been issued regarding the demands.
